Transaction 176a902eaf08d82440848ff49bee80882d82cd7fc4e6d02b73b2ceb321022b65
2 Input
2 Outputs
- 176a902eaf08d82440848ff49bee80882d82cd7fc4e6d02b73b2ceb321022b65:0
- 176a902eaf08d82440848ff49bee80882d82cd7fc4e6d02b73b2ceb321022b65:1
value 2396743
address 14vFVRU1CHMhRjs5uq4yDsyFAnozAvV2dp
value 4171000
address 3Ha2HM5YboSfQXD1EpbqFQFnGYF53Fg5SB